What Is a PDO Thread Lift?

A PDO Thread Lift is a non-surgical facial rejuvenation treatment that uses medical-grade polydioxanone (PDO) threads—safe, dissolvable sutures—to lift areas of mild to moderate skin laxity. Once inserted, the threads anchor sagging tissue and gradually stimulate collagen production, improving firmness and elasticity over time. As the threads dissolve, the newly formed collagen remains, supporting fresher, tighter, more youthful-looking skin.

PDO Thread Lift Procedure Details

How PDO Threads Lift & Tighten the Skin

MINT™ PDO threads are strategically placed beneath the skin to reposition sagging tissue, creating an immediate lift. As the body naturally responds to the threads, collagen production increases along the treatment pathways. This dual effect delivers both instant shaping and long-term tightening, improving texture, firmness, and overall contour.

Types of PDO Threads

PDO threads come in several variations, each designed for a different goal. Smooth threads stimulate collagen and improve fine lines. Barbed threads anchor loose skin, providing a more visible lift to the cheeks, jawline, and lower face. Twisted or “screw” threads restore volume in hollow areas. Your StudioMD provider selects the ideal thread combination to match your anatomy and rejuvenation goals.

What to Expect During Treatment

Your appointment begins with a detailed facial assessment and a personalized treatment plan. A topical or local anesthetic is used for comfort. The threads are then inserted through tiny entry points using thin, specialized cannulas. Most appointments take 30 to 60 minutes, depending on the areas treated. Once complete, you’ll notice an immediate change in lift and contour with minimal downtime.

Who Is a Good Candidate?

PDO threads are ideal for patients experiencing early to moderate sagging in the cheeks, jawline, brows, neck, or lower face. They are also an excellent choice for individuals who prefer a non-surgical option or want to postpone a facelift. Patients with more advanced skin laxity may require additional or alternative treatments for optimal results.

PDO Thread Lift Recovery

Recovery is typically minimal. Mild swelling, soreness, or tightness can occur for several days but does not interfere with most daily activities. We recommend avoiding strenuous exercise, exaggerated facial movements, and pressure on the treated areas for about one week. Most patients resume work and their normal routines the same day or the day after. As the threads settle and collagen production increases, the lift becomes more refined, with steadily improving firmness and texture.


PDO Thread Lift Results

While some lift is visible immediately, full results develop gradually over the next several weeks as collagen grows along the thread pathways. Most patients experience optimal improvement after 4–6 weeks, with results lasting up to a year or more, depending on factors such as skin quality, lifestyle, and thread type. The final effect is a naturally lifted, smoother, more youthful contour without looking stretched or surgical.

Frequently Asked Questions PDO Thread Lift

How long do PDO threads last?

The threads dissolve over 4–6 months, but collagen remodeling keeps the lifting effect visible for up to 12 months or longer.

Is the treatment painful?

Most patients find the procedure very tolerable. Numbing medication is used to keep the experience comfortable.

How soon will I see results?

You’ll notice an immediate lift, with continued improvement as collagen builds over the following weeks.

Can PDO threads be combined with fillers or Botox?

Yes. PDO threads pair beautifully with fillers, neurotoxins, and skin rejuvenation treatments for comprehensive facial rejuvenation.

Are PDO threads safe?

When performed by trained medical professionals, PDO threads are considered very safe. Side effects are typically minimal and temporary.
